When I invite new employees and they complete their part of the i-9 form, I get an invitation to fill the employer side of that form. The problem is that the form shows and old business address I previously used by default and I have to change it manually every time there is a new hire. I called support but they said my addresses are all updated in all places and couldn't figure out why it's happening. Any advise on that?
The details you've provided are much appreciated, @americanm1. I'll point you in the right direction to ensure your old business address doesn't appear in your i-9 form when accepting invitations to fill out the employer fields on the form.
Please know that the address used in your tax and eligibility forms is the legal address you entered in the Account and settings in QBO.
